A “gripping” Agatha Christie thriller, Love From a Stranger, is the next offering in Royal and Derngate’s Made in Northampton season, playing in Northampton for three weeks before going on a nationwide tour.

This rarely-seen play by “the UK’s greatest crime writer” will be presented in a new production by Lucy Bailey who is currently directing Christie’s Witness for the Prosecution at the County Hall, London and also directed Patrick Hamilton’s Gaslight on the Northampton Royal stage in 2015.

The full cast has been revealed which includes Justin Avoth (Nigel Lawrence), Helen Bradbury (Cecily Harrington), Sam Frenchum (Bruce Lovell), Alice Haig (Mavis Wilson), Molly Logan (Ethel), Crispin Redman (Dr Gribble), Nicola Sanderson (Louise Garrard) and Gareth Williams (Hodgson).

Design is by Mike Britton whose credits in Northampton include Mike Poulton’s adaptation of Charles Dickens’s A Tale of Two Cities in 2016.

Presented in association with Fiery Angel, Love From a Stranger by Agatha Christie and Frank Vosper takes to the Royal stage from Friday 23 February until Saturday 17 March.

It then tours to Oxford Playhouse, Yvonne Arnaud Theatre Guildford, Marlowe Theatre Canterbury, New Theatr Cardiff, Liverpool Playhouse, Richmond Theatre, Curve, Leicester, New Alexandra Theatre Birmingham, Cambridge Arts Theatre, Theatre Royal Plymouth, Edinburgh King’s Theatre, Theatre Royal Newcastle, Everyman Theatre Cheltenham, Theatre Royal Glasgow, Milton Keynes Theatre, The Lowry Salford and Theatre Royal Norwich from 17 until 21 July.
